Why Choose a Bean-to-Cup Coffee Machine?
Bean-to-cup coffee machines offer a myriad of benefits over standard coffee-making approaches. Here are some crucial advantages:
- Freshness: Grinding beans simply before developing ensures a fresher, more tasty cup of coffee.
- Convenience: These machines often include grinders, brewing units, and milk frothers, improving the coffee-making procedure.
- Adjustable Taste: Users can control grind size, brewing time, and strength, enabling for a customized coffee experience.
- Flexibility: Many machines offer various coffee designs, from espresso to cappuccino, all from the same gadget.

Types of Coffee Machines for Beans
When it pertains to coffee machines that make use of beans, several ranges accommodate different choices and needs:
- Bean-to-Cup Machines: These machines handle the entire process from grinding to brewing instantly.
- Manual Espresso Machines: These require a more hands-on approach for grinding and brewing, providing more control to seasoned enthusiasts.
- Semi-Automatic Coffee Machines: These permit for manual grinding but automate parts of the developing procedure, making them ideal for those who appreciate workmanship coupled with convenience.
- Smart Coffee Makers: Integrating smart innovation, these devices can be configured remotely, providing features such as grind size choice and developing strength modifications via mobile apps.

FAQs About Coffee Machines from Beans
Q1: How can I preserve my bean-to-cup coffee machine?
A: Regular cleansing and descaling are vital. Most machines include automatic cleaning cycles, however manual cleaning of the mill and brewing elements will lengthen the machine's life expectancy.
Q2: What types of beans can I use in these machines?
A: Most machines can handle a variety of beans, however constantly describe the manufacturer's recommendations. Fresh, premium beans will yield the best results.

Q4: Can I use pre-ground coffee in a bean-to-cup machine?
A: Some machines permit the use of pre-ground coffee, however the primary function is created for whole beans to keep freshness.
Q5: Are there any particular brands known for quality bean-to-cup coffee machines?
A: Yes, brand names like Breville, De'Longhi, Jura, and Gaggia are well-respected in the market for reputable and high-quality machines.
